【发布时间】:2016-06-20 04:26:18
【问题描述】:
ElasticSearch 在尝试使用以下查询查找条目时返回“query_parsing_exception”、“reason”:“[bool] 查询不支持”错误。我认为问题与“query_string”有关
curl -XGET '<myurl>:<myport>/index/_search?pretty' -d '
{
"query": {
"bool": {
"must":[ {
"term" : {
"query" : "1.2.3.4",
"fields" : [ "ip" ]
}
},{
"range" : {
"localtime" : {
"from" : "2016-06-15T06:00:04.923Z",
"to" : "2016-06-17T17:43:04.923Z",
"include_lower" : true,
"include_upper" : true
}
}
},
"query_string" : {
"default_field" : "_all",
"query" : "word1 OR word1",
} ]
}
}
}'
为什么会出现这个错误?
谢谢
任何帮助将不胜感激!谢谢!
【问题讨论】:
标签: elasticsearch query-string